Assistive Technology Advocacy
Offered by Georgia Advocacy Office, Inc. (GAO)
GAO helps people with disabilities address barriers to getting assistive technology and related services, such as communication tools, mobility aids, environmental controls, and school or workplace accommodations.

Who this is for
People with disabilities in Georgia who need help accessing or keeping assistive technology or services.
How to apply
Contact GAO about the assistive technology problem, such as a denial, delay, equipment failure, or accommodation issue.
